Field Secure Area Sensor Monitoring Functional Object

Description

'Field Secure Area Sensor Monitoring' includes sensors that monitor conditions of secure areas including facilities (e.g. transit yards), transportation infrastructure (e.g. Bridges, tunnels, interchanges, and transit railways or guideways), and public areas (e.g., transit stops, transit stations, rest areas, park and ride lots, modal interchange facilities). A range of acoustic, environmental threat (e.g. Chemical agent, toxic industrial chemical, biological, explosives, and radiological sensors), infrastructure condition and integrity and motion and object sensors are included.

Functional Requirements

IDRequirementUser Defined
1The field element shall include security sensors that monitor conditions of secure areas including facilities (e.g. transit yards) and transportation infrastructure (e.g. bridges, tunnels, interchanges, roadway infrastructure, and transit railways or guideways).False
2The field element sensor monitoring shall be remotely controlled by a center.False
3The field element shall provide equipment status and fault indication of security sensor equipment to a center.False
4The field element shall include environmental threat sensors (e.g. chemical agent, toxic industrial chemical, biological, explosives, and radiological).False
5The field element shall include infrastructure condition and integrity monitoring sensors.False
6The field element shall include motion and intrusion detection sensors.False
7The field element shall include object detection sensors (such as metal detectors).False
8The field element shall provide raw security sensor data.False
9The field element shall remotely process security sensor data and provide an indication of potential incidents or threats to a center.False
10The field element shall include security sensors that monitor conditions in traveler secure areas, which include transit stations, transit stops, rest areas, park and ride lots, and other fixed sites along travel routes (e.g., emergency pull–off areas and travel information centers).False
